Police urgently searching for missing newborn baby in Halifax

A newborn is missing in Halifax — every minute counts this morning.

Halifax police and ground search crews are urgently searching a neighbourhood after officers discovered a woman in life-threatening condition who appeared to have recently given birth. A newborn baby is currently missing and authorities are treating the situation as an emergency. The search is ongoing.
